Имя: Пароль:
1C
1С v8
Оформление ячейки
0 Light-Lexa1
 
02.12.12
19:32
Пока еще нуб, сильно не издевайтесь.
Красный = Новый Цвет(255, 0, 0);
Если СтрокаТаблицы.Цена2 <> Строка.цена Тогда
  ЭлементыФормы.ТоварыМенедж.Колонки.Цена.ЦветФонаПоля = Красный;
КонецЕсли;
Вот у меня сравнило две цены, они не равны и вся колонка с ценой стали красный.
А как сделать что бы красной стала только та ячейка, в которой цены не ровны?
Заранее спасибо.
1 Light-Lexa1
 
02.12.12
19:35
Это в одной табличной части сравнивает. Одна цена взята из файла excel а вторая из регистра сведений.
2 mih_io
 
02.12.12
19:48
Надо использовать метод табличной части при выводе строки

и использовать переменную
ОформлениеЯчейки

В данном случае как-то так
ОформлениеЯчейки.ячейки.Цена.ЦветФона = Красный;